fix: rich messages follow-ups — reply_parameters, send latch, opt-in default
- Use reply_parameters per the sendRichMessage spec instead of the undocumented reply_to_message_id scalar (silently ignored -> reply anchor quietly dropped). - Latch rich sends off after an endpoint-capability failure (old PTB / server without sendRichMessage) so every later reply doesn't pay a doomed extra roundtrip; per-message BadRequests do NOT latch. - Default rich_messages to OFF (opt-in) while the day-old Bot API 10.1 endpoint is validated live; revert the prompt-hint table guidance until the default flips on. - Tests: reply_parameters shape, send-latch behavior, BadRequest non-latch; rich tests opt in explicitly via extra.
